Weeping Tile Repair in Birmingham, AL
Weeping tile repair services focus on restoring the drainage system around a property’s foundation to prevent water intrusion and structural damage. This service involves diagnosing issues such as clogs, cracks, or disconnections in the weeping tile system, which is designed to channel excess groundwater away from the foundation. Repairs can include replacing damaged sections, sealing leaks, or installing new drainage components to ensure proper water flow and reduce the risk of basement flooding or foundation shifting.
Homeowners considering weeping tile repair often want to understand the signs of potential problems, such as persistent dampness in basements, musty odors, or visible water pooling near the foundation. It’s also important to assess the age and condition of existing drainage systems, as well as any previous water issues. Proper evaluation helps determine the appropriate repair approach, ensuring the property’s foundation remains stable and protected from water damage over time.

Weeping Tile Repair Questions
What is weeping tile repair? It involves fixing or replacing the drainage system around a foundation to prevent water intrusion and damage.
When should weeping tile be repaired? Repairs are needed if there are signs of basement flooding, excess moisture, or visible damage to the drainage system.
What are common signs of weeping tile issues? Signs include damp basement walls, mold growth, and pooling water around the foundation.
How does weeping tile repair protect a property? It helps maintain a dry foundation, reducing the risk of structural damage and mold growth over time.
